Summit Elementary School

Summit Elementary School is Casper, Wyoming’s newest elementary school. Construction was completed in Summer 2010 and the school opened for classes in the Fall of 2010.

Site design plans for the school were completed in May of 2009. CEPI worked in conjunction with the developer and the Natrona County School District to plat an 11-acre parcel along with a surrounding Gosfield Subdivision.

CEPI designed streets and utilities around the site and completed studies for water, sanitary sewer, and storm sewer. The site had grading, water, and sanitary sewer design and layout along with storm water design. In addition to the subdivision and site design, it was determined that an intersection light at Wyoming Boulevard and Centennial Village Drive would be necessary. CEPI worked with Wyoming Department of Transportation and the City of Casper to design a signal light for the intersection.

Upon completion of the design for all three projects, CEPI was responsible for construction staking, construction inspection, and contract administration for all three projects.
